Introduction
Pivot is a turn based RPG that follows mechanics similar to those of games like Final Fantasy or Pokemon. The game features Caralia Tersov as the main character, alongside her associates Preston Porland and Zen. The three of them have been arrested for committing crimes against Sargaia City’s capitalistic elite and have been sentenced to death. However, a power outage allows them to escape from their cells and attempt to break out of the Sargaia City Penitentiary.
Pivot is still very early in development, though it will feature a dialogue system similar in function to the one showcased here, as well as having a similar art style. All assets seen on this page have been created by Jakob Gottschalk.

Character Profiles
The following information deals with the three main characters of Pivot. The information offered is a quick summary of character traits, given with the intent of establishing a quick introduction to a character and summarizing what makes them unique.
Name: Caralia Tersov
Age: 25
Gender: Female
Appearance: A woman on the shorter end, with a bulky build. She had dark brown skin, curly black hair, and golden eyes. She wears a heavy jacket over a t-shirt, and has on ratty jeans and leather gloves. Her hands underneath her gloves are actually high tech prosthetics that she designed herself.
Personality: Caralia is excitable and energetic, with a bit of a hotheaded streak. She is quick to feel emotions of any sort, and always tries to freely express herself.
Skills: Large experience with programming and mechanical and electrical engineering.
Backstory: Caralia was a part of the Sargaia City orphanage system for as long as she could remember. Her lonely days led her to play around with some broken electronics, and it wasn’t long before Caralia discovered that she was a natural with them. Her knowledge eventually allowed her to escape the orphanage system, and led her to live on the streets, doing odd jobs as a freelancer. A lot of illegal work later led to her arrest, and also led an individual known as ‘the Director’ to her. Caralia joined the Director’s ranks, and served as a head technician in their electronics division.
Name: Preston Porland
Age: 33
Gender: Male
Appearance: A man easily describable as ‘average’, standing at a normal height. He has silver hair, a five o’clock shadow, fair skin, and brown eyes. He usually wears a white suit vest over a black button up and a tie. He also wears dress pants and shoes, and is usually smoking a cigarette. His clothing tends to be rumpled and unkempt, giving him a ragged appearance.
Personality: Preston is apathetic and pessimistic, often prone to inaction even when in danger. Despite that, there is a hidden wisdom to him, and he’s smarter than his ragged appearance does justice.
Skills: Large knowledge of business and management practices, as well as minor self defense techniques.
Backstory: Preston used to be a successful business owner, who was rich, well known, and well respected. Then, his company and reputation were trashed due to a combination of a sudden smear campaign, internal sabotage, and a heavy hit to his company’s stock prices. As Preston was discarded by those he considered associates, costing him everything he owned, he fell into a deep depression and turned to drinking to soothe his soul. However, he was found by a mysterious person known only as ‘the Director’, who recruited him into a group to stop the corruption in Sargaia City. Preston joined the Director’s ranks, serving as the head of logistics for the group.
Name: Zen
Technical Age: 6
Gender: Male
Appearance: A humanoid robot standing at an even 6 feet. His limbs are bulkier than a regular human, and his joints are riveted. His head appears like that of a knight’s frog mouth helm, with two blue glowing eyes inside. Zen is made of a dark, steely gray metal.
Personality: Zen is cold and blunt, with a concerning fondness for his work. He fully embraces his place as a ruthless assassin, and takes an almost sadistic pleasure in ‘taking care’ of his targets.
Skills: Proficiency with all forms of conventional ranged weaponry, and has stealth and assassination training.
Backstory: Zen was custom designed and commissioned by the person known only as ‘the Director’ in order to assist with their more… urgent and direct needs. Zen was used over the course of five years to eliminate key targets with a focus on the destabilization and crippling of important organizations. Over the years, Zen developed his sadistic enjoyment of his duties, and has remained wholly loyal to the Director throughout the entirety of his life.
